No fewer than 10 persons have been confirmed dead in a boat mishap in the Shiroro Local Government Area of Niger State.

The Head of Relief and Rehabilitation in the Niger State Emergency Management Agency (NSEMA), Garba Salihu, disclosed this in Minna, the state capital, on Friday.

Salihu said the boat mishap occurred at about 2 p.m. in Shiroro on Thursday, adding that the incident was caused by water hyacinth, strong waves, and a grafting tree.

He said the boat left Zangoro Bassa/Kukoki ward terminal to Gijiwa/Kato ward terminal in Shiroro Local Government Area where it capsized.

Salihu disclosed that 34 passengers were on the boat with 20 male and 14 female.

He said 24 survivors had been rescued and one body recovered, adding that a search and rescue operation was ongoing to recover the remaining missing persons.

The NSEMA official stated that those who lost their lives were Farida Muntari, Sharhabila Sagir, Abubakar Sadiq, Na’ima Ibrahim, Amina, Safaratu Ibrahim, Sadiq Ibrahim, Rafiya Yakubu, and other two bodies unidentified.

Salihu said the boat had six drivers who were Dahiru Yusuf, Sa’idu Shu’aibu, Ahmadu Garba, Sa’idu Garba, Abdulaziz Yahaya, and Lukuman Sani.

He added that the Chairman of Shiroro LGA alongside the agency desk officer had visited the scene of the incident.
